Form 4: Expedia Group Officer Reports RSU Vesting and Tax Withholding
Insider Transaction Report
Expedia Group's SVP & Chief Accounting Officer, Lance A. Soliday, reported the vesting of restricted stock units and subsequent tax-related share disposition.
Summary
- Lance A. Soliday, SVP & Chief Accounting Officer of Expedia Group, Inc., reported transactions on November 15, 2025.
- The transactions involved the vesting of Restricted Stock Units (RSUs) and the subsequent withholding of shares for tax obligations.
- A total of 1,126 shares of common stock were acquired through the vesting of RSUs (366, 329, 252, and 179 shares from different grants).
- 277 shares of common stock were disposed of at a price of $264.66 per share to cover tax liabilities related to the RSU vesting.
- Following these transactions, Soliday beneficially owns 12,511 shares of common stock directly.
- Remaining derivative securities (RSUs) beneficially owned are 179, 1,649, 2,272, and 3,291 units, with various vesting and expiration dates.
